Info on a '74 144S 140-160

There were two major changes between 73 and 74. The 73 had a 6-bolt engine
with D-Jetronic fuel injection. The 74 had CIS (AKA K-jetronic) fuel injection
and the new 8-bolt engine which shared crankshaft and rods with the B21 and
later engines and consequently had different pistons also. Everything else
was pretty much the same.
